The grid of each career event is specifically cast and the entire career mode is held in the original game's database.bin file. The DLCs are add-on .bin files meaning they can't read or write or otherwise interact with the original database.bin. No trivial matter to add DLC cars to career mode haha. Someone would have to go event-by-event and I unfortunately don't have the time to do that right now.

The issue here is there's a limit to the number of `free_race_restrictions` that Grid supports. I've bumped into that limit at adding 4 cars to the 24h Le Mans event.
In my update I'll add the Le Mans track to the Prototype series but there's no extra space to add the Prototype cars to the actual 24h event.
